pubblicato 9 giu 2017, 02:36 da Giorgio Davanzo
Nella pagina degli esami trovate il testo e la correzione della parte di programmazione; ecco l'esito dell'esame. Per chi l'ha passato: please fatemi sapere se viene accettato o meno.
Iniziali |
Matricola |
Esito |
Commento |
A. G. |
IN0400388 |
Insufficiente |
la funzione di check-in non fa realmente nulla; stampa posti liberi ritorna un booleano? |
L. P. |
IN0100386 |
Ritirata |
|
F. P. |
IN0100356 |
Insufficiente |
programmazione-filtro: non funziona, usa finale per testare il valore ma lì ancora non c'è niente e dopo ogni IF viene ritornato il valore --> finisce al primo ciclo; nel programma principale manca la funzione di checkin (ci sono poche righe, ma non utili) |
D. S. |
IN0100338 |
20 |
Uso non corretto di generaNumeroCasuale; numFile e numPosti (se inseriti) era meglio farli privati; l'array dei posti non ha le dimensioni corrette con l'uso che se ne fa; il metodo checkIn non funziona al 100%: già il primo passeggero riempie tutti i posti |
F. T. |
IN0100513 |
Insufficiente |
Il costruttore non fa la cosa giusta: mette un passeggero in ogni cella dell'array, che quindi non sarà mai vuoto; stampaPostiLiberi cicla solo su una delle due dimensioni dell'array (x non è mai incrementato); il checkIn non funziona realmente per lo stesso motivo (e perché non assegna mai la persona al posto) |
S. U. |
IN0400350 |
Insufficiente |
Il costruttore non fa la cosa giusta: mette un passeggero in ogni cella dell'array, che quindi non sarà mai vuoto. Stampa posti liberi non funziona, perché sono tutti già riempiti dal costruttore---inoltre l'uso dei doppi array non funziona così come fatto; idem la ricerca del posto |
W. V. |
IN0100520 |
Ritirato |
|
B. Z. |
IN0100460 |
Ritirata |
|
|
|